Historical Significance and Architecture
The buildingās construction dates back to 1889, and its architectural style is a beautiful example of Collegiate Gothic. Itās a prominent feature of the Illinois College campus quad, offering a picturesque view and a connection to the collegeās long history. Originally designed as a classroom and office building, Baxter Hall has evolved over time to serve a wider range of functions. Notably, it houses a small snack shop, providing a convenient spot for students and faculty, and a guest apartment ā a space historically utilized for scholars in residence, offering a unique opportunity for engagement and intellectual exchange.
